A method and apparatus for installing distributed objects on a distributed
object system is described. In one aspect the distributed objects include
wrapper classes that inherit object attributes through an inheritance
relationship with a developer-written servant class of objects, the
developer-written servant classes inheriting attributes through an
optional inheritance relationship with an interface class of objects. In a
preferred embodiment, the wrapper classes provide an interface mechanism
between the methods of the servant class of objects and the object request
broker mechanism of the distributed object system. Also included is an
apparatus for creating and installing the distributed object in the memory
of a computer on a distributed object system. The invention further
includes a mechanism for distinguishing deployed distributed objects from
development distributed objects.
Un metodo e un apparecchio per l'installazione degli oggetti distribuiti su un sistema distribuito dell'oggetto è descritto. In una funzione che gli oggetti distribuiti includono i codici categoria che ereditano gli attributi dell'oggetto con un rapporto di eredità con un codice categoria sviluppatore-scritto del servo degli oggetti, il servo sviluppatore-scritto dell'involucro classifica l'eredità degli attributi con un rapporto facoltativo di eredità con un codice categoria dell'interfaccia degli oggetti. In un metodo di realizzazione preferito, i codici categoria dell'involucro forniscono un meccanismo dell'interfaccia fra i metodi del codice categoria del servo degli oggetti ed il meccanismo del mediatore di richiesta dell'oggetto del sistema distribuito dell'oggetto. Inoltre è incluso un apparecchio per la generazione e l'installazione dell'oggetto distribuito nella memoria di un calcolatore su un sistema distribuito dell'oggetto. L'invenzione ulteriore include un meccanismo per la distinzione degli oggetti distribuiti schierati dagli oggetti distribuiti sviluppo.